Harris >Release: 7.0-STABLE >Organization: Solitox Networks >Environment: FreeBSD 7.0-STABLE #2: Tue Mar 11 12:33:19 EDT 2008 root@vesper.int.sykotik.org:/usr/src/sys/amd64/compile/VESPER >Description: GEOM outputs to the console, sometimes obscuring its own output and the output of other console messages. The text is often one character from geom alternating with one character from other output. It is a minor aesthetic issue only and has no effect on system stability, however it can make debugging certain things a bit more difficult on the console. >How-To-Repeat: This has occured while unplugging an msdosfs USB flash dongle (geom complains about msdosfs disk label, usb is telling me about the usb device going away), and during shutdown (not sure exactly what is being said by geom here, it's very difficult to read due to how the "syncing disks" output occurs). >Fix: >Release-Note: >Audit-Trail: >Unformatted:
